Steele’s two doubles help ASU sweep Utah

(Photo: Josh Frons/WCSN)

Haley Steele had two RBI doubles as the Arizona State softball team completed the series sweep on Saturday afternoon, 7-4 over the Utah Utes.

The Sun Devils were down two runs entering the bottom of the sixth after Utah outfielder Marissa Mendenhall hit a three-run home run in the top of the inning. With the game tied up at 4, Haley Steele hit her second double of day, scoring Alix Johnson and Allie Butterfield to give ASU the 6-4 lead.

“Our offense kind of got going in that sixth inning,” said coach Craig Nicholson. “I thought today our approach at the plate was a lot better.”

Alix Johnson led off the bottom of the first with a single and later scored on a Haley Steele double to give the Sun Devils a 1-0 lead. Utah responded in the top of third after an error by ASU outfielder Elizabeth Caporuscio put runners on second and third for infielder Hannah Flippen, who hit a sac fly that scored Kristen Stewart.

“I saw the ball well today,” said Steele. “I made some minor adjustments during the weekend and came out and executed today.”

Dallas Escobedo celebrated her 22nd birthday by picking up her 18th win of the season. She carried a one-hitter into the sixth inning until the three-run home run by Mendenhall. After the five-run sixth inning, Escobedo retired all three batters in order in the seventh to give ASU their 37th victory this year. She gave up four runs (three earned), four hits, and struck out two.

“I did okay,” said Escobedo. “It was kind of like going threw the motions. We weren’t as up (energy) as we could and should have been.”

The Sun Devils travel to Washington next weekend.
